English[edit]

Proper noun[edit]

Balbuena (plural Balbuenas)

  1. A surname from Spanish.

Statistics[edit]

  • According to the 2010 United States Census, Balbuena is the 7223rd most common surname in the United States, belonging to 4621 individuals. Balbuena is most common among Hispanic/Latino (91.13%) individuals.
